Output 80af4beea79a346ee7649f3acefad3915f1d08cb2d342993b2bb677c2e53c0a3:3

value
11571393
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f42740589fab087efbb78a06ba4cd90bba54e9a5 OP_EQUAL
address
3Pwypaib7msNyMaQ7BszzRyN7uUYUEGWGZ
transaction
80af4beea79a346ee7649f3acefad3915f1d08cb2d342993b2bb677c2e53c0a3
spent
true